Scarehouse has been a Pittsburgh institution during the Halloween season for over 20 years, but it won't be opening this year.

Pittsburgh Magazine's Kristy Graver talked about it on the Big K Morning Show Thursday.


"Owner Scott Simmons says there are tentative plans for smaller-scale experiences throughout the year and ideas for a future revival, but like a full-scale resurrection of the popular haunted attraction that was in Etna for years then moved to Pittsburgh Mills, that would take a significant outside investment," said Graver.

Simmons hopes to have Scarehouse up and running again in the coming years.
